summaryrefslogtreecommitdiffstats
path: root/classes
diff options
context:
space:
mode:
authorJun Zhu <junzhu@nxp.com>2023-03-22 19:53:17 +0800
committerJun Zhu <junzhu@nxp.com>2023-03-22 11:50:52 +0800
commit9018954bf1edd518dc15d2d294de36a40e4ecc59 (patch)
tree9b6d397035fe7aac15dc8be7fe5700d8d929de17 /classes
parent6b76bef852e103438ad66a3e803fb551e9608ffc (diff)
downloadmeta-freescale-9018954bf1edd518dc15d2d294de36a40e4ecc59.tar.gz
use-imx-security-controller-firmware.bbclass: SECO_FIRMWARE_NAME as weak variable
With `SECO_FIRMWARE_NAME` weak variable, user can update with new name when new version is released. Signed-off-by: Jun Zhu <junzhu@nxp.com>
Diffstat (limited to 'classes')
-rw-r--r--classes/use-imx-security-controller-firmware.bbclass14
1 files changed, 7 insertions, 7 deletions
diff --git a/classes/use-imx-security-controller-firmware.bbclass b/classes/use-imx-security-controller-firmware.bbclass
index 062d6455..9ae58fbc 100644
--- a/classes/use-imx-security-controller-firmware.bbclass
+++ b/classes/use-imx-security-controller-firmware.bbclass
@@ -16,15 +16,15 @@
16# This behavior ensures that derivatives which requires SECO Firmware to be 16# This behavior ensures that derivatives which requires SECO Firmware to be
17# present in the image file have it properly defined. 17# present in the image file have it properly defined.
18 18
19SECO_FIRMWARE_NAME ?= "" 19SECO_FIRMWARE_NAME ?= ""
20SECO_FIRMWARE_NAME:mx8qm-nxp-bsp = "mx8qmb0-ahab-container.img" 20SECO_FIRMWARE_NAME:mx8qm-nxp-bsp ?= "mx8qmb0-ahab-container.img"
21SECO_FIRMWARE_NAME:mx8qxp-nxp-bsp = \ 21SECO_FIRMWARE_NAME:mx8qxp-nxp-bsp ?= \
22 "${@bb.utils.contains('MACHINE_FEATURES', 'soc-revb0', 'mx8qxb0-ahab-container.img', \ 22 "${@bb.utils.contains('MACHINE_FEATURES', 'soc-revb0', 'mx8qxb0-ahab-container.img', \
23 'mx8qxc0-ahab-container.img', d)}" 23 'mx8qxc0-ahab-container.img', d)}"
24SECO_FIRMWARE_NAME:mx8dx-nxp-bsp = "mx8qxc0-ahab-container.img" 24SECO_FIRMWARE_NAME:mx8dx-nxp-bsp ?= "mx8qxc0-ahab-container.img"
25SECO_FIRMWARE_NAME:mx8dxl-nxp-bsp = "mx8dxla1-ahab-container.img" 25SECO_FIRMWARE_NAME:mx8dxl-nxp-bsp ?= "mx8dxla1-ahab-container.img"
26SECO_FIRMWARE_NAME:mx8ulp-nxp-bsp = "mx8ulpa1-ahab-container.img" 26SECO_FIRMWARE_NAME:mx8ulp-nxp-bsp ?= "mx8ulpa1-ahab-container.img"
27SECO_FIRMWARE_NAME:mx93-nxp-bsp = "mx93a0-ahab-container.img" 27SECO_FIRMWARE_NAME:mx93-nxp-bsp ?= "mx93a0-ahab-container.img"
28 28
29python () { 29python () {
30 if "mx8m-generic-bsp" in d.getVar('MACHINEOVERRIDES').split(":"): 30 if "mx8m-generic-bsp" in d.getVar('MACHINEOVERRIDES').split(":"):